How To Be A Better Boyfriend Through Open Communication

Good communication is the heart of any healthy relationship. When you talk openly, you build trust and avoid confusion. Many relationship problems start with unspoken feelings or assumptions. Learning to share your thoughts clearly makes everything easier.

Listen More Than You Speak

Listening is a skill that takes practice. When your partner shares something, give her your full attention. Put your phone away. Make eye contact. Nod to show you understand. Do not interrupt or plan your response while she is talking.

Active listening means you care about her perspective. You can say things like, “I hear you,” or “That makes sense.” These simple words show you value what she is feeling. Over time, she will feel safe opening up to you.

Speak Your Truth With Kindness

Honesty matters, but how you say things matters just as much. Use a calm tone. Avoid blame. Focus on your own feelings instead of pointing fingers. For example, say “I feel worried when we do not talk about our plans” instead of “You never tell me anything.”

Kind honesty builds respect. It shows you are committed to solving problems together. When both partners feel heard, conflicts become easier to handle.

Check In Regularly

Do not wait for big issues to talk. Make time for quick check-ins during the week. Ask how her day went. Share something small about your own life. These moments keep you connected and prevent distance from growing.

A simple text like “Thinking of you, how is your day?” can brighten her mood. Regular contact keeps your bond strong even during busy times.

Building Trust And Showing Reliability

Trust is the foundation of love. Without it, nothing else feels secure. Learning how to be a better boyfriend means proving through your actions that you are dependable. Trust grows slowly, but it can break quickly if you are not careful.

Keep Your Promises

Follow through on what you say you will do. If you promise to call, call. If you plan a date, show up on time. Small broken promises add up and make your partner doubt your word. Consistency proves you care.

When you cannot keep a promise, communicate early. Say, “I am sorry, something came up. Can we reschedule?” This shows respect and responsibility. Your partner will appreciate the honesty.

Be Transparent About Your Life

Share your plans, your feelings, and your challenges. Hiding things creates suspicion. When you are open, your partner feels included in your world. Transparency does not mean sharing every single thought, but it does mean being genuine about important matters.

If you are stressed about work or family, say so. Let her support you. Relationships are a two-way street, and sharing your struggles invites deeper connection.

Respect Her Privacy And Boundaries

Trust also means giving space. Everyone needs time alone or with friends. Do not demand constant updates or check her phone. Respect her privacy, and she will trust you more. Healthy boundaries make both partners feel safe.

When you honor her limits, you show maturity. This builds a relationship based on mutual respect, not control.

Handling Conflict With Care

Disagreements happen in every relationship. What matters is how you handle them. Fighting fair builds trust and understanding. It also shows maturity and love.

Stay Calm During Arguments

When emotions run high, take a breath. Do not raise your voice or use hurtful words. If you need a break, say so politely. “I need a few minutes to cool down so I can listen better” is a healthy approach.

Staying calm helps you think clearly. It prevents small issues from turning into bigger problems. Your partner will feel safer knowing you can handle conflict without exploding.

Focus On The Problem, Not The Person

Attack the issue, not each other. Avoid phrases like “You always” or “You never.” These sound accusatory and shut down conversation. Instead, talk about the specific situation and how it affects you.

Work as a team to find a solution. Ask, “How can we fix this together?” This mindset turns conflict into collaboration. It strengthens your bond instead of weakening it.
